How to fill out delineation of pathology privileges
How to fill out delineation of pathology privileges:
01
Start by reviewing the requirements and guidelines provided by the governing body or organization that requires the delineation of pathology privileges.
02
Familiarize yourself with the specific form or document that needs to be filled out. Make sure you understand the sections and information required.
03
Begin by providing your personal information, such as your name, contact details, and professional credentials.
04
Clearly state your current medical or pathology specialty and any additional certifications or qualifications you hold.
05
Describe your relevant education and training in the field of pathology. Include details about your residency, fellowships, and any advanced courses or workshops you have completed.
06
Outline your professional experience and work history. Include details about your current and previous positions, as well as any leadership or administrative roles you have held.
07
Specify the specific pathology privileges that you are seeking or currently have. This may include areas such as surgical pathology, cytopathology, hematopathology, or forensic pathology.
08
Provide any supporting documents or evidence of your expertise in the designated areas of pathology. This may include publication records, conference presentations, or awards and recognition.
09
Include any additional information that may be relevant to your application for delineation of pathology privileges. This could be participation in quality improvement projects, research initiatives, or teaching and mentoring activities.
10
Review and double-check all the information you have provided to ensure accuracy and completeness. Make sure all required sections are filled out and any necessary attachments or supporting documents are included.

What is delineation of pathology privileges?
Delineation of pathology privileges is the process by which an institution evaluates and grants specific clinical privileges to pathologists.
Who is required to file delineation of pathology privileges?
Pathologists who are seeking clinical privileges at a healthcare institution are required to file delineation of pathology privileges.
How to fill out delineation of pathology privileges?
To fill out delineation of pathology privileges, pathologists must provide information on their education, training, experience, and any relevant certifications.
What is the purpose of delineation of pathology privileges?
The purpose of delineation of pathology privileges is to ensure that pathologists are competent to perform specific clinical procedures and services.
What information must be reported on delineation of pathology privileges?
Information such as education, training, experience, and certifications must be reported on delineation of pathology privileges.
